The Painting specialization forms a core component of the Painting and Printmaking concentration. This artistic domain fosters a supportive atmosphere for students to grow into practicing artists. The program aims to establish strong fundamentals in observational abilities and technical proficiency, while cultivating knowledge of both historical traditions and modern practices in painting and drawing. Students are motivated to apply these foundational elements inventively, investigating diverse conceptual approaches and forging their own artistic paths. Central to the Painting curriculum is the creation of two-dimensional works using conventional painting and drawing techniques. As students progress, the program emphasizes blending these methods with other two-dimensional arts like printmaking and photography, and when relevant, incorporating three-dimensional elements.
